Skip navigation

Gene C25E10.12

Symbol C25E10.12
Name UPF0046 protein C25E10.12
Synonym CELE_C25E10.12
Top Interacting
Chemicals
NCBI Gene ID 182896 Caenorhabditis elegans
External Links